『Deep secrets of maglev Shinkansen emerging』
The Linear Chuo Shinkansen, a dream ultraexpress maglev train system that will likely come into use in 2027, features a variety of unique innovations.
One thing Central Japan Railway Co. (JR Tokai) is especially proud of concerning the railway tracks used for the maglev train system is technology that overcomes a great difference of elevation of up to 1,300 meters―from a maximum of 100 meters underground in Tokyo to a tunnel 1,200 meters high near the Southern Japanese Alps.
The Linear Shinkansen's biggest selling point is its speed, which exceeds 500 kph. To make best use of this point, the railway operator selected the shortest route possible to Nagoya. Along the route,however, sit the giant mountains of the Southern Japanese Alps. The Linear Shinkansen will climb these mountains using technology that is better than any other bullet train.
Regular railways cannot climb more than 30 meters per kilometer since the ability of a train's wheels to "grab" the tracks decreases as speed increases. The Linear Shinkansen, however, is expected to mount steep inclines of 40 meters per kilometer around the border of Kanagawa and Yamanashi prefectures.
The new train will run through tunnels and under concrete sound barriers, which will largely prevent riders from enjoying the view. One solution is to place small windows at regular intervals in the sound barriers so that custmers see what would look like an unbroken view view of the outside scenery, somewhat like a flip-book comic. JR Tokai is considering using this idea in sections of the route where Mt. Fuji is visible.
